Here's what seems to have worked for me.

Go to your "Program Files (x86)" folder and find the "BoneTown" folder. Right-click it and select "properties". If the folder has "read only" highlighted, uncheck it and hit "apply". You should be prompted to apply it to just that folder, or all subfolders. I chose all subfolders. Now it gets past that point in the game.

It makes no sense that the game folders should be read-only. I don't know why it installed this way from a download version. The game needs to write save files and such.
